**Currant Stuffing**

**Ingredients:**
– 1 loaf of day-old bread, cubed
– 1/2 cup dried currants
– 1/2 cup unsalted butter
– 1 large onion, diced
– 2-3 celery stalks, diced
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 2 teaspoons fresh thyme, chopped
– 1 teaspoon fresh rosemary, chopped
– 1 teaspoon fresh sage, chopped
– 1 1/2 cups chicken or vegetable broth
– Salt and pepper to taste

**Instructions:**
1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a baking dish.
2. In a large sk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the diced onion, celery, and garlic, cooking until softened and fragrant, about 5-7 minutes.
3. Stir in the fresh thyme, rosemary, and sage, cooking for an additional 2 minutes to let the herbs release their flavors.
4.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cubed bread and dried currants. Pour the sautéed vegetable and herb mixture over the bread.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
5. Carefully pour the chicken or vegetable broth over the bread mixture, ensuring that the bread absorbs the liquid evenly. Mix gently to combine all ingredients.
6. Transfer the stuffing mixture into the prepared baking dish, spreading it out evenly.
7. Cover the dish with foil and bake in the preheated oven for 30 minutes. Then, remove the foil and bake for an additional 15 minutes or until the stuffing is golden brown on top.
8. Once done, remove the stuffing from the oven and let it rest for a few minutes before serving.
9. Serve warm alongside your favorite main dishes and enjoy the delicious flavors of this Currant Stuffing with your loved ones.
